#820df0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#820df0 is composed of 51% red, 5.1%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.8%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 270.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 49.6%. #820df0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1aff with #0500e1.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

#820df0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#820df0 has RGB values of R:130, G:13,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 8523248.

Hex triplet 820df0 #820df0
RGB Decimal 130, 13, 240 rgb(130,13,240)
RGB Percent 51, 5.1, 94.1 rgb(51%,5.1%,94.1%)
CMYK 46, 95, 0, 6
HSL 270.9°, 89.7, 49.6 hsl(270.9,89.7%,49.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 270.9°, 94.6, 94.1
Web Safe 9900ff #9900ff
CIE-LAB 40.122, 78.774, -86.155
XYZ 25.075, 11.325, 83.298
xyY 0.209, 0.095, 11.325
CIE-LCH 40.122, 116.739, 312.438
CIE-LUV 40.122, 14.415, -124.771
Hunter-Lab 33.653, 74.113, -123.2
Binary 10000010, 00001101, 11110000

Shades and Tints of #820df0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090111 is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#820df0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7885 is the less saturated color, while #8203fa is the most saturated one.
